Week 11 is the earliest in terms of eligibility off of IR. With the torn meniscus the ability to return also depends on how thorough of a recovery he and the coaches want to go with. Given his history of recovering quicker than most, I wouldn't put it past him to be ready but he's also at the point in his career both in age and contract that MIN might want to keep him healthy. I think a lot of it will depend on where MIN is in terms of the playoff picture.

 

I could still see it being a race to the top of the NFC North between them and GB, but if MIN locks it in early then they would probably let him rest until real world playoffs.
